Red Bull admit they have no support

Red Bull advisor Dr. Helmut Marko has revealed that the Milton Keynes-based side are still alone in their criticism of the 2026 regulations, which will see a complete overhaul of the power unit rules. Red Bull, of course, are going to be completely dependent on themselves from 2026 onwards, with the Austrians set to supply their own power units. From 2026, sustainable fuel will be used whilst the engines themselves will be V6 hybrid engines, with a 50/50 ratio of electrical power output and internal combustion.
